Is providing <br />constructability review, project coordination, <br />resident engineering, and construction inspection <br />services for the Mid -Basin Injection Wells Project <br />located within the City of Santa Ana's 87-acre <br />Centennial Park. The project requires <br />close coordination with the City of Santa Ana, Santa Ana Unified School District, <br />Heritage Museum, and state and federal agencies.
